I wanted to take one of my Summer dresses and make it cooler weather appropriate, so here’s some tips…
Add a jacket... this should be the first step! Arms get cold, people!
Throw on some warmer weather accessories. I found this hat at the new Primark in Boston. It’s a wool hat, but the floppy shape reminds me of a beach hat, so it’s the perfect transition piece.
Bring out the Vamp… lip that is. nothing says Fall like add a deep plum or burgundy lip.
Cover up anything else that could get cold. I’m not quite ready to whip out the tights, but in a month I’ll need to for sure. Another month after that I won’t be able to leave the house without a scarf. Adjust your look for the temperature for style and comfort.
